>ok. then i don't sell 49%. only sell <100 minus
If you own more than 75% or something you can do whatever the fuck you want, yeah.
But you'd never make a big company out of it in the first place because you'd never grow at a significant rate without investors.
So you'd have small company that you own completely but that couldn't pay you zilch instead of a behemoth that would make you and your investors rich.

>but noone ever gets any actual benefit from being a minority shareholder in my company, it's purely speculation.
>they don't pay out any dividends, stockholders get 0 ACTUAL benefit from being monority owners of their companies. the only thing giving value to their stocks is speculation.
No, it's not speculation, it's literal ownership of your company. The company's worth is largely determined by its earnings. Look at pic relate. Do you think stockholders give a fuck about dividends?
Plus if you really fuck your stockholders over they can sue you because ownership gives them legal rights.

>say i deal with serious people, who actually want to make money. why would they give a crap about my company's public valuation when they know it's fallen while my actual revenues went 100x, thus have no connection with my company's success?
If your revenue would grow that much the stock's value would, too, so investors would never dump it. That wouldn't make any sense.
Besides when I say financing deals I'm talking about getting lower interest rates on financing. Finance analysts care a lot about your stocks worth.
So when your stock gets dumped you have to pay higher interest rates which in turn lowers your revenue and so on.

>but once i share my majority, i don't get to keep all the revenue for myself.
You don't get to keep the revenue in any case. What you get to keep is the profit which again is only a fraction of the revenue.
Facebook only makes less then $4B in profits while being worth $500B. It just makes zero sense to fuck your investors over.
